Cost
The cost of a spare key for cars key can vary widely depending on the service you choose. In general, standard keys with no transponder chips can be duplicated for around $10. Keys with high-security transponder chips are more expensive. They require special programming to function with the ignition system of the vehicle. They are therefore more difficult to replace in the event of a loss or theft. They can be replaced by the dealer, which can increase the cost.

The cost to cut the spare key for your car may differ depending on the place you purchase it and the kind of key you want to cut. The standard method of key cutting involves a machine that scans the grooves on your primary key to create a duplicate. This is the most economical alternative for Car Keys Spare older vehicles that don't come with key fobs. Some key-cutting companies aren't capable of duplicateing the transponder chip, so make sure they have the right equipment before you purchase your spare cut.
For modern cars it is necessary to go to a dealership or a locksmith that specializes in your particular car's key system. These technicians will be able to cut a new key for you and program it so your car recognizes it as the right one. It can be expensive to replace a key that has a transponder.
